We sell some rams here. We keep about 50 intact and keep cutting for any reason we don't like them. We will band them up to 100#. Make sure you give them a cdt shot or a tetanus for sure. It is hard on them and will set them back. We get a .10 discount on rams lambs so that $15 a head for a 150#lamb. That can add up. One year we didn't band them for the above reasons and those rams chased the ewe lambs non stop so we felt we'd take the hit on the few bucks and not every ewe lamb. That whole shove their nuts up an band them- they still act like rams and will still chase the ewes, I would think the buyers will frown on you if they figure out who's doing it. On a side note if you can sell some kill lambs off the farm or don't get discounted leave them intact and feed them in a seperate pen. We eat a couple Buck lambs every year and they taste the same as the rest.
